SQL SERVER FOR LINUX初体验

Posted 雪飞鸿

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了SQL SERVER FOR LINUX初体验相关的知识,希望对你有一定的参考价值。

今天得空,就在Ubuntu17.04上安装了SQL SERVER 2017体验下,总体来说还是不错的。

SQL SERVER 2017

在Ubuntu上安装SQL SERVER 2017还是比较方便的,只需几条命令即可:

curl https://packages.microsoft.com/keys/microsoft.asc

sudo add-apt-repository "$(curl https://packages.microsoft.com/config/ubuntu/16.04/mssql-server.list)"

sudo apt-get update
sudo apt-get install -y mssql-server

sudo /opt/mssql/bin/mssql-conf setup

目前,在安装SQL SERVER 2017有7个版本可供选择,我选了免费的EXPRESS版。执行完上述命令,会提示你有175天的试用期,如果你选择的是免费版(free),是可以一直使用的,无需理会这条消息。

完成安装后,可通过命令

systemctl status mssql-server

来查看SQL SERVER 2017的运行状态

SQL SERVER 2017运行状态
 

微软提供了和数据库交互的命令行工具,但我选择了JetBrains(大名鼎鼎的ReSharper就是这家公司的杰作)出品的DataGrip,DataGrip对多种数据库都提供了良好的支持,本文开头的配图就是DataGrip。

JetBrains的产品对于学生、MVP、开源项目开发者是免费的。最后再安利一款JetBrains的产品,Rider,一款跨平台的.NET开发工具,可以有效降低在Linux上写.NET CORE程序的痛苦指数。

参考文档

Install SQL Server and create a database on Ubuntu

版权声明

本文为作者原创,版权归作者雪飞鸿所有。 转载必须保留文章的完整性,且在页面明显位置处标明原文链接

如有问题, 请发送邮件和作者联系。

以上是关于SQL SERVER FOR LINUX初体验的主要内容,如果未能解决你的问题,请参考以下文章

迅飞SDK for Linux 初体验

python flask初体验linux命令发射器

Qt for Python 5.12初体验

Xamarin.Forms for iOS初体验

Xamarin.Forms for iOS初体验

Xamarin.Forms for iOS初体验